School supply lists for two elementary schools (Parkway and Springhill) are posted at bryantschools.org/page/supply-lists.
School supplies are provided for students at Bryant Elementary, Collegeville, Davis, Hill Farm, Hurricane Creek & Salem Elementary Schools by their PTOs. Students at these schools will only need headphones and a backpack. Leakproof water bottles are optional.
On the first day of school, secondary teachers (grades 6-12) will let students know what supplies are needed for their classrooms.
